Mike Lyons was at Pan Asia Hash in Jakarta at the beginning of September
collecting a few registrations for Interhash '98. Bill Panton was with him
collecting information for Hash Geneology. Mike is still active with
Interhash '98 as there are many other hashers in KL. I am not sure how
active Mike is on Internet. He did indicate he had a problem with his
personal computer which when resolved gave him a back log of a hundred or
so messages. He did indicate KL Interhash '98 were trying to resolve some
issues related to the service provider for the KL home page which was to
also contain information from the official Travel agent SA tours. The page
seems to have died totally now.
There is an office for Interhash '98 Phone +603 242 9783, +603 242 9798,
Fax +603 242 9796 as per Interhash Flyer #1. There is no official email
address for Interhash '98. Personal experience suggests there is a back
log of sending out the actual registration numbers but the fliers #1 and
the information from SA Tours which gives all the details of how to book
accommodation appears to have been sent out to all who forwarded their
registrations. Twenty registrations sent in December 96 by me have not been
acknowledged but all those included have recieved directly personal copies
of Flier #1 and material form SA Tours detailing Accommodation options and
Pre and Post Tour Option and details of MAS Airfare offers. All are
obviously registered on some sort of system in KL and being processed.
Malaysia Airlines Systems within Australia are now making contact directly
about booking for Interhash Convention. This mailing list must have been
initiated by the KL Interhash Organisers.
The reality of dealing with thousands of registrations with a volunteer
work force as Hashing events are must be a real problem in KL. There is no
doubt The Hashes of Klang Valley will deliver. It will be the biggest
hashing event ever, could be as many as 6000. Be patient. It is over a
year away yet and the folks in KL are doing their best.
